Transaction 22d33177166120741fbba33a59a7a3eff0e042b717cbd5a25b23767b828fad96
1 Input
2 Outputs
- 22d33177166120741fbba33a59a7a3eff0e042b717cbd5a25b23767b828fad96:0
- 22d33177166120741fbba33a59a7a3eff0e042b717cbd5a25b23767b828fad96:1
value 956550
address 18i8XjUatc8FJ7Ubj37crv5UH7AA9ourYZ
value 8083980
address 1HYfBH5UrmJeqJaT7F8e96o2JdCoXbVaG7